Which or flashcard hardware are you currently using?
If you keep encountering a white screen right after the Capcom or homebrew splash logo, the file itself is likely broken. Download a freeware MD5 generator tool on your computer.
If the game keeps crashing, try re-downloading the ROM from a different source, as your previous download might have been incomplete.
If you insist on using your existing NDS flashcart (R4, Ace3DS+, etc.), you cannot play NDS files. However, you can install only if your flashcart is running on a 3DS/2DS console. Street Fighter 4 Nds Rom Download Fix
Street Fighter 4 NDS Rom Download Fix: How to Play SF4 on Nintendo DS
Before you give up on your search for a "Street Fighter 4 Nds Rom Download Fix," run through this final checklist:
: The original DS lacked the 3D processing power to run the Street Fighter IV engine, which is why Capcom developed it specifically for the 3DS. Common Issues & Real Solutions If you are trying to play a portable version of Street Fighter IV Which or flashcard hardware are you currently using
If you are playing a traditional DS fighting game and experiencing issues:
An original Nintendo DS ROM must end in a extension. A Nintendo 3DS ROM must end in .3ds or .cia .
The standard for desktop emulation. Highly accurate, but requires a decent PC to run at full speed. If the game keeps crashing, try re-downloading the
Download the specific .dldi file that matches your flashcart firmware (e.g., R4, DSTT, or Ace3DS).
Despite this limitation, the emulation and homebrew communities have created various demakes, fan-made projects, and compressed ROM hacks designed to bring the spirit of Street Fighter 4 to the Nintendo DS. Additionally, players using modern 3DS flashcarts or emulators often look for ways to run the 3DS version or custom DS homebrew files.
If you are playing on actual Nintendo DS, DS Lite, or DSi hardware using a flashcard, loading errors usually stem from outdated firmware.
: Street Fighter 4 relies on 3D graphics, complex physics, and advanced rendering engines. The Nintendo DS hardware uses an ARM9 and ARM7 processor setup that cannot handle these asset requirements.